Traffic Alert 3/9
520 Main Street, Windermere, FL, United StatesWHO: Orange County Utilities WHAT: Water Service Install WHERE: 712 Main Street. Both lanes will be shut down. barricades, flagmen, and/or detour signage will be in place. This will primarily […]